当前位置: 代码迷 >> J2EE >> 高分求:HQL里字符串联接,进者有分
  详细解决方案

高分求:HQL里字符串联接,进者有分

热度:289   发布时间:2016-04-22 03:36:03.0
高分求:HQL里字符串连接,进者有分
oracle库,
我要实现select r.year+'年' from table1 r,用HQL,过路的兄弟们帮帮忙啊

------解决方案--------------------
先做个table1的javabean,里有个year的字段,
然后就,select r.year from table1 r,其实和sql差不多的
------解决方案--------------------
class UserYear{
private String year;

public UserYear(){}

public UserYear(String year){
this.year = year + "年";
}
  
public void setYear(String year){
this.year = year + "年";
}

public String getYear(){
return this.year;
}
}

然后:
hql = "select new UserYear(r.year) from YourTable r ";
  相关解决方案